## What is the Governance of Governance Model Resilience?

The framework encompassing rules, processes, and mechanisms governing cryptocurrency protocols, options exchanges, and derivatives markets is increasingly scrutinized for its ability to withstand shocks and adapt to evolving conditions. Effective governance models are crucial for maintaining trust, ensuring stability, and fostering long-term sustainability within these complex ecosystems. A resilient governance model proactively addresses potential vulnerabilities, incorporates feedback loops for continuous improvement, and establishes clear lines of responsibility to navigate unforeseen challenges. This necessitates a balance between decentralization, efficiency, and adaptability, particularly in the face of regulatory changes or technological disruptions.

## What is the Resilience of Governance Model Resilience?

In the context of decentralized finance (DeFi) and derivatives trading, resilience signifies the capacity of a governance model to maintain functionality and integrity despite adverse events, such as market manipulation, protocol exploits, or governance attacks. It extends beyond mere robustness to encompass the ability to recover quickly and adapt effectively to changing circumstances. Quantitative risk management techniques, including stress testing and scenario analysis, are essential for evaluating and enhancing governance resilience, particularly concerning the impact of systemic risk. A resilient system anticipates potential failures and implements proactive countermeasures to mitigate their impact.

## What is the Algorithm of Governance Model Resilience?

The underlying algorithms governing on-chain voting, parameter adjustments, and dispute resolution mechanisms are fundamental to governance model resilience. These algorithms must be designed to resist manipulation, ensure fairness, and provide transparency in decision-making processes. Sophisticated cryptographic techniques, such as verifiable random functions (VRFs) and zero-knowledge proofs, can enhance the security and integrity of governance algorithms. Regular audits and formal verification are crucial for identifying and addressing potential vulnerabilities within these algorithmic components, ensuring the long-term stability of the system.
